⚡ How It Works During the Day

Solar panels naturally produce voltage during daylight, even under cloudy conditions. This voltage, although sometimes low, is enough to indicate that a panel is still connected and functional.

The monitoring circuit checks the presence of voltage at the terminals of each panel. If no voltage is detected, it means:

  • The panel has been physically removed

  • There is a major disconnection or failure

In either case, the alarm is triggered immediately.


🌙 Monitoring at Night or in Poor Weather

At night, or when panels are inactive due to heavy clouds or bad weather, voltage may not be present, making detection more difficult.

To solve this, the circuit injects a small DC voltage into the panel and measures the current flow. Thanks to built-in protection diodes in solar panels, current can flow in the reverse direction.

  • If all panels are still connected: a return current is detected

  • If even one panel is missing: current flow is interrupted

This method ensures 24/7 monitoring—day or night, rain or shine.


🔐 Local or Remote Alarm Activation

Depending on your needs, the system can:

  • Trigger a siren or buzzer at the installation site

  • Send a remote alert via SMS, Wi-Fi module, or other control systems

This makes it perfect for both urban rooftop installations and isolated solar farms where physical supervision isn't always possible.
